BH Air, also known as Balkan Holiday Airlines, was established in 2001 and is based in Sofia, Bulgaria. The airline primarily operates charter flights to popular holiday destinations in Europe, North Africa, and the Middle East. With a fleet of modern aircraft, BH Air prides itself on providing safe and reliable air transportation services to its customers.

One of the first things that passengers look for when considering an airline is its safety record. BH Air has been operating for nearly two decades without any major safety incidents, which is a positive indicator of the company’s commitment to safety and maintenance standards. The airline’s fleet consists of Airbus A320 and A330 aircraft, which are known for their reliability and safety features. Additionally, BH Air is regulated by the European Union Aviation Safety Agency (EASA), which sets strict safety and operational standards for airlines operating within the EU.

In terms of customer satisfaction, BH Air has received a range of reviews from passengers who have flown with the airline. Some customers have praised the company for its friendly and attentive staff, comfortable seating, and on-time performance. Others have criticized the airline for its limited in-flight entertainment options, average food offerings, and occasional delays. It is important to note that many of these reviews are subjective and can vary based on individual experiences.
